This sculptural lamp reflects Bettina’s passion for upcycling. It is made of a combination of many different components, mostly discarded objects and waste materials which show a child falling down. With a focus on composition and proportions, waste material is processed and combined in surprising ways to achieve a new life in a new context.
Detailed Features
● Type: Lamp
● Dimensions: 46 H x 17 W cm
● Material: Metal, wood, ceramics
● Date: 2021
